Object Number 46-73-10/44269
Display Title Ceramic human effigy sherd
Descriptions
Object Description Fragment of pottery human face, probably from a red-on-buff jar.
Inventory Description Ceramic human effigy sherd, applied coffee bean eyes and molded nose, red, paint
Classification
  • Effigy
Department Archaeological
Culture
  • Hohokam
Geography/Provenience/Site Name
North America / United States / Arizona / <County> / <City> / Pueblo de las Cenizas
Additional Geographic Terms Salado Valley, Lower; Gila, middle
Materials Ceramic
Dimensions Overall: 5.1 x 3.3 x 2.4 cm (2 x 1 5/16 x 15/16 in.)
Quantity 1
Label on object 3962/ 46-73-10/44269
Provenance
Collector Frank Hamilton Cushing (01/01/1886-01/01/1889)
Collector Hemenway Southwestern Archaeological Expedition (01/01/1886-01/01/1889)
Donor Mary T. Hemenway (11/15/1946)
